I find it fascinating that even though you tuned each string on the E-board to one note, you can still hear the original note as an overtone because that's still predetermined by the actual length of the string, as opposed to how tight you wind it up
@daydodog
@daydodog Год назад
Uhhhhh, what, how
@Dragongaga
@Dragongaga Год назад
@@daydodog The tech points it out briefly. There's actually two waves on each string. One is the oscillation of the string itself, as it's vibrating with it's resonance frequency after being hit, the other one is the impulse wave of the hammer traveling up and down the string from the point of impact. It's the difference between sound moving through a solid object (which is determined by the speed of sound for any given material) and the whole object moving itself, which is determined by its size and mass. Usually the two are the same if the string is tuned correctly, but as it isn't on the E-board, you can always hear both notes. The one that is natural to the string and the one the string is tuned to. You can sort of hear it when he's hitting the single keys in a row
